The 90-second self-check
Look at the cap for gap or crushing, walk the crown for hairline cracks (68 freeze-thaw days a year here will find any weakness), and shine a light up the flue for glazing. Photograph anything unclear and text it over.
When to stop using the appliance
Any active water ingress, visible flame licking outside the firebox opening, or the smell of gas products in the room means shut down and call. Insurance coverage on damage during "known unsafe operation" is thin.
Signs the cap replacement can't wait
The most reliable early warnings on Cobourg homes: smell changes near the appliance, staining above the firebox or on interior ceilings, unusual soot at the cap, and any water inside the smoke chamber. Any one of these is a call — two together is a stop-use.

When's the best time of year for cap replacement in Cobourg?
Late September through mid-November with Cobourg averaging 123cm of snow starting December. Spring (April–May) is the second window and often 10–15% cheaper.

Do you need a permit for cap replacement in Cobourg?
Cleaning and inspection are permit-exempt in Cobourg. Structural masonry, liner replacement, or a new appliance install typically need one — we pull it as part of the job when required.
